Irish striker David Eguaibor has joined Lee Cattermole's Gateshead on a two-year deal from Scottish League One side Cove Rangers.

Eguaibor, 22, scored 11 goals in his one season with Cove following his move from Irish side Cobh Ramblers.

He told the National League club website, external: "When I went to Scotland, I learned a lot. I learned fast as well and hopefully I can bring that here, score goals and get regular game time as well.

"I can't wait to get started. I just want to come in, score goals and work hard."
